[quote=Anonymous]You do know for SS normal Retirment age is 67. And although Medicare is 65 is you have a stay at home spouse she needs to be 65 to get Medicare. A man for instance with a two year younger wife working till 67 is pretty normal as that is his full SS and his wife now old enough for Mediare. Also if you went to Law School or Medical School you had a delayed start to career or if you suffered layoffs over years your savings may behind track. My BIL still works at 69. He got laid 2001 for a year and in 2008 laid off again for almost two years. He had to do early wirthdrawls 401ks and HELOCs back then. So he is catching up. He plans to retire at 70 for full SS. So what. Is he just supposed to quit cause someone 50 wants his job. [/quote]
